At 91 years old, Gloria was no stranger to life’s challenges. As a widow living independently, she had weathered many storms on her own. But when she wasn’t feeling quite right one day, she made the brave decision to drive herself to the hospital—a decision that would change the course of her journey.

Diagnosed with congestive heart failure, Gloria faced an uncertain prognosis. Doctors discussed hospice care, but Gloria, with her remarkable resilience, remained unfazed. Having navigated adversity throughout her life as a Jewish woman, she turned to art as a means of processing emotions and combating discrimination. Her journey led her to become a civil rights activist, embodying courage and determination in the face of injustice.

With her health declining, Gloria’s son Corey made the selfless decision to move to Wilmington to care for her full-time. However, Gloria’s home lacked accessibility, presenting a significant challenge. Desperate for assistance, Corey reached out to the New Hanover Senior Resource Center, who connected him with WARM NC.

On a poignant day, as Corey and Gloria shared a prayer on Yom Kippur, a knock on the door heralded the arrival of WARM NC, ready to measure the home for a much-needed ramp. This serendipitous moment marked the beginning of a renewed sense of hope and possibility for Gloria and Corey.

Four years later, Gloria continues to defy the odds, embracing life with her son in their accessible home. Corey expresses profound gratitude to WARM NC for their invaluable support, acknowledging the role they played in extending his mother’s life.
